My Buying Guides on Kayak Holder For Truck
When I started looking for a kayak holder for my truck, I realized there are a lot of options, and not all of them work the same way. I wanted something that would keep my kayak secure, protect my truck, and make loading as easy as possible. After comparing different styles and features, I learned what really matters before buying. Here’s my guide based on what I found most important.
1. Know the Type of Kayak Holder I Need
The first thing I considered was the type of kayak holder that would fit my truck and my kayaking habits. Some holders mount on the truck bed, some use a roof rack, and others attach to a hitch. I had to think about how often I would use it and whether I wanted quick loading or maximum stability.
- Truck bed racks: Great for keeping the kayak elevated and secure.
- Roof-mounted holders: Good if I already have a roof rack system.
- Hitch-mounted holders: Helpful for easy access and lower loading height.
2. Check Compatibility with My Truck
I made sure the kayak holder would actually fit my truck before buying. Truck beds, cab sizes, and rack systems vary a lot, so compatibility matters. I checked the product dimensions, weight limits, and whether any drilling or extra hardware was required.
3. Look at Weight Capacity
One of the most important things I looked at was weight capacity. My kayak may not be extremely heavy, but I still wanted a holder that could support it safely, especially during long drives or on rough roads. I always chose a holder with a little extra capacity for peace of mind.
4. Focus on Security and Stability
I didn’t want my kayak shifting around while I drove. I looked for holders with strong straps, padded contact points, and solid locking features. A stable holder helps prevent scratches on my kayak and damage to my truck.
- Strong tie-down straps
- Anti-slip padding
- Locking mechanisms for added security
5. Think About Loading and Unloading Ease
Since I often load my kayak by myself, ease of use mattered a lot. I preferred a holder that made lifting and securing the kayak less of a struggle. Some models have fold-down arms, rollers, or adjustable supports that made the process much easier for me.
6. Choose Durable Materials
I wanted a kayak holder that could handle weather, sun, and regular use. I looked for steel or aluminum construction with a rust-resistant coating. That way, I knew it would last longer and hold up well over time.
7. Consider Adjustability
Adjustability was another feature I found useful. A holder that can be adjusted gives me more flexibility if I ever switch kayaks or use the same setup for different trips. Adjustable arms and brackets made the holder more practical for my needs.
8. Check for Extra Protection
I paid attention to whether the holder had padding or protective surfaces. My kayak has to sit on the holder for hours at a time, so I wanted to avoid dents, scratches, or wear. Extra cushioning made a big difference for me.
9. Review Installation Requirements
Before buying, I looked at how difficult the installation would be. Some kayak holders are easy to install with basic tools, while others need more setup time. I preferred something I could install myself without professional help.
10. Balance Price and Quality
I learned that the cheapest option is not always the best. I compared price with build quality, features, and customer reviews. For me, spending a little more on a reliable holder was worth it because I wanted something safe and long-lasting.
